Lead Quality Operations and the Quality Management System (QMS) for a San Diego manufacturing site, ensuring compliance with regulatory, customer, and business requirements. This role provides strategic and operational leadership across Quality Assurance and Quality Control, drives continuous improvement and risk management, and partners closely with site leadership to strengthen product quality, operational performance, and customer satisfaction. Reports to the Quality Director and works cross-functionally with Operations, Production, Engineering, Customer Service, and Sales.

Responsibilities
  • Own the QMS and Quality Operations, ensuring compliance with regulatory, customer, and business requirements
  • Provide leadership, coaching, talent development, and performance management for QA/QC teams
  • Develop and maintain quality systems, procedures, controls, and metrics to ensure consistent product and process quality
  • Establish quality objectives and KPIs aligned with business goals
  • Lead quality risk management across products, processes, suppliers, and quality systems throughout the product lifecycle
  • Ensure effective management of CAPA, nonconformances, deviations, complaints, adverse events, and change controls
  • Lead Management Reviews and report quality performance, compliance, risks, and improvement initiatives to executive leadership
  • Direct internal, supplier, customer, certification, and regulatory audit programs, ensuring timely closure of findings
  • Ensure audit readiness and lead Quality representation during inspections
  • Establish and maintain a supplier quality management program, including qualification, monitoring, audits, and performance reviews
  • Promote a prevention-based quality culture through training, risk management, and continuous improvement initiatives
Requirements
  • Bachelor's degree in Engineering, Manufacturing, Quality, or a related field
  • 5–7 years of experience in Engineering and/or Quality, preferably in medical device
  • 3+ years in a supervisory or management role
  • Experience with quality risk management principles in a regulated manufacturing environment
  • Expertise in manufacturing processes, quality systems, inspection methods, root cause analysis, nonconformance management, and CAPA processes
  • Track record leading teams and driving continuous improvement in quality, compliance, and business performance
  • Proficient in MS 365 applications
  • Experience with ERP/MRP systems, electronic QMS (eQMS), and data analytics/reporting tools
  • Comfortable working in both office and manufacturing environments
